Work May Begin This Summer On New Connector From Highway 58 To VW; 4-Lane Highway Will Go Through 52-Acre Marsh

  • Tuesday, May 14, 2013

Work may begin this summer on a new four-lane highway that will go from Highway 58 at Clark Road to the Volkswagen Plant.

The new road will cross the middle of a 52-acre wetland, City Engineer Bill Payne said.

He said the entire wetland will be preserved under a conservation easement. He said the tract includes a number of different type water birds, beavers, deer and other wildlife.

Bids will be open for the project on May 24.

Current estimated cost is approximately $6.5 million.

The project length is 1.360 miles, and the completion time is on or before the end of September next year.
